ورژن (3 بٹس)
موجودہ ڈیوائسز کے لیے ہمیشہ 0۔ مستقبل کے پروٹوکول نظرثانی کے لیے محفوظ۔
معیارات · Matter ڈیوائس کمیشننگ
جب آپ کسی اسمارٹ بلب، اسمارٹ پلگ، کانٹیکٹ سینسر، یا Matter لوگو والے دروازے کی تالے کے پچھلے حصے پر QR اسکین کرتے ہیں، آپ کا فون پانچ مرحلے کا ہینڈ شیک چلاتا ہے جو ڈیوائس کو آپ کے گھر میں شامل کرتا ہے۔ QR میں آپ کے ہب کی وہ سب کچھ ہے جو اس مخصوص ڈیوائس کو تلاش کرنے کے لیے ضروری ہے — وینڈر، ماڈل، فی ڈیوائس discriminator، اور یک بار پیئرنگ پاس کوڈ۔
Matter Connectivity Standards Alliance (CSA) کا شائع کردہ ہے، جو پہلے Zigbee Alliance تھا، Apple، Google، Amazon، Samsung، Comcast کی بانی حمایت کے ساتھ۔ Matter 1.0 اکتوبر 2022 میں آیا؛ Matter 1.4 2026 کے اوائل تک موجودہ ہے۔
پیئرنگ-QR فارمیٹ Matter Core Specification کا حصہ ہے، "Onboarding Payload" سیکشن۔ ایک ہی پے لوڈ کی تین شکلیں ہیں:
MT: پریفکس ہو اس کے بعد Base38-انکوڈڈ blob۔ زیادہ تر ایپس یہی پسند کرتی ہیں کیونکہ یہ تیز ہے۔تینوں ایک ہی فیلڈز ایک ہی اعتماد ماڈل کے ساتھ انکوڈ کرتے ہیں — کمیشننگ کے نقطہ نظر سے یہ قابل تبادلہ ہیں۔
MT: پریفکس کے بعد Base38 پے لوڈ ایک پیکڈ بائنری ڈھانچے میں ڈی کوڈ ہوتا ہے۔ لازمی فیلڈز:
موجودہ ڈیوائسز کے لیے ہمیشہ 0۔ مستقبل کے پروٹوکول نظرثانی کے لیے محفوظ۔
CSA کا صنعت کار کے لیے تفویض کردہ شناخت کنندہ۔ ہر رکن تنظیم کو منفرد وینڈر ID ملتا ہے؛ 0xFFF1–0xFFF4 ٹیسٹ/ترقی کے لیے محفوظ۔ ہمارا اسکینر جہاں معلوم ہو CSA رجسٹری کے خلاف وینڈر ID resolve کرتا ہے۔
صنعت کار کا مخصوص ماڈل کے لیے تفویض کردہ شناخت کنندہ۔ وینڈر ID کے ساتھ مل کر، یہ ایک SKU کو منفرد طور پر شناخت کرتا ہے (مثلاً "Eve Energy 2nd gen")۔
0 = معیاری کمیشننگ (بس پیئر کریں)، 1 = صارف-عمل مطلوبہ (مثلاً پہلے ڈیوائس پر بٹن دبائیں)، 2 = کسٹم فلو (صنعت کار-مخصوص سیٹ اپ اقدامات)۔ طے کرتا ہے کہ آپ کا ہب ایپ کیا UI دکھائے۔
ایک bitmask کہ ڈیوائس اپنی غیر کمیشنڈ حالت میں کیسے دریافت ہو سکتی ہے: BLE (سب سے عام)، آن-نیٹ ورک IP (پہلے سے آپ کے Wi-Fi یا Ethernet پر)، Soft-AP (ڈیوائس عارضی Wi-Fi نیٹ ورک ہوسٹ کرتی ہے)، Wi-Fi PAF (جدید)۔
ایک مختصر شناخت کنندہ جو ڈیوائس دریافت کے دوران اعلان کرتی ہے تاکہ آپ کا ہب صحیح غیر کمیشنڈ ڈیوائس کو BLE رینج میں کئی موجود ہونے پر پہچان سکے۔ خفیہ نہیں — یہ "یہ وہی ہے جو میں نے ابھی کھولا" اشارہ ہے۔
PASE ہینڈ شیک میں استعمال ہونے والا مشترک راز۔ فون ڈیوائس کو ثابت کرتا ہے کہ اس کے پاس یہ پاس کوڈ ہے بغیر اسے فضا میں سادہ متن میں بھیجے۔ ایک بار کمیشننگ مکمل ہوئی، پاس کوڈ مزید مفید نہیں۔ رینج: 1 سے 99,999,998 (کچھ قدریں اسپیک کے ذریعے ممنوع)۔
اختیاری فیلڈز پے لوڈ کو ڈیوائس سیریل نمبر، rendezvous معلومات، اور دیگر صنعت کار-مخصوص خصوصیات کے ساتھ بڑھا سکتی ہیں۔ زیادہ تر صارف ڈیوائسز یہ چھوڑ دیتی ہیں۔
Matter کی کمیشننگ فلو PASE → CASE ہے:
کلیدی خصوصیت: QR پاس کوڈ قلیل مدتی توثیق ہے، طویل مدتی شناخت نہیں۔ ایک بار ڈیوائس کمیشن ہوئی، QR اسٹیکر کو دراز میں رکھیں (یا اکھیڑ کر پھاڑ دیں)۔ دوبارہ کمیشننگ کے لیے یا تو ڈیوائس تک جسمانی رسائی سے فیکٹری-ری سیٹ، یا موجودہ fabric سے کمیشننگ ونڈو اپ ڈیٹ کرانا ضروری ہے۔
Matter کے لیے منفرد — QR کمیشننگ سے پہلے آپریشنل طور پر معنی خیز ہے۔ دیگر زمروں سے موازنہ:
حقیقی دنیا کے منظرنامے جہاں یہ اہمیت رکھتا ہے:
دفاع: ڈیوائس کھولتے ہی کمیشن کریں (ونڈو بند)، پھر اسٹیکر اکھیڑ کر پھاڑ دیں۔ مشترک/عوامی جگہوں پر تعینات ڈیوائسز کے لیے یقینی بنائیں کہ ڈیوائس ایک fabric سے کمیشنڈ ہے — یہ فیکٹری ری سیٹ کے بغیر نئی پیئرنگ کو روکتا ہے۔
ہمارے اسکینر میں Matter QR (تصویر، پیسٹ، یا کیمرہ) ڈالیں۔ فیصلہ دکھاتا ہے:
ہم آپ کے ہب کو کال نہیں کرتے یا کمیشننگ کی کوشش نہیں کرتے۔ ڈی کوڈ مقامی ہے؛ صرف میٹا ڈیٹا ہمارے سرور تک حفاظتی درجہ بندی کے لیے پہنچتا ہے۔
0xFFF1–0xFFF4) استعمال کرتی ہیں کیونکہ CSA رکنیت مہنگی ہے۔ ہمارا اسکینر ٹیسٹ وینڈر IDs کو فلیگ کرتا ہے۔QR ڈالیں (تصویر، پیسٹ، یا کیمرہ)۔ فیصلہ وینڈر، پروڈکٹ، discriminator، صلاحیتیں، اور ماسک شدہ پاس کوڈ دکھاتا ہے۔ ہم آپ کے ہب سے رابطہ نہیں کرتے یا کمیشننگ کی کوشش نہیں کرتے — ڈی کوڈ مقامی ہے اور صرف میٹا ڈیٹا حفاظتی درجہ بندی کنندہ تک پہنچتا ہے۔